The heart of “Currency Trading” revolves around swapping one currency for another. This trading practice occurs in pairs, like the EUR/USD (Euro/US Dollar) or USD/JPY (US Dollar/Japanese Yen). The first currency in the pair is called the base currency, and the second currency is the quote currency.

  • The exchange rate tells you how much of the quote currency is needed to purchase one unit of the base currency.
  • The constant fluctuation that happens in the forex market is mostly caused by the forces of supply and demand.
  • You are not required to hold physical paper money” while executing transactions online in the forex market, there are forex trading platforms that give you access to trade.

There are two major types of analysis:

  • Fundamental Analysis: This type of analysis involves analyzing economic and geopolitical factors that can influence currency movements. It often involves studying interest rates, inflation, and political stability.
  • Technical Analysis: Technical analysis is a type of analysis that uses charts and in some cases, indicators. to make trading decisions. You look for patterns and trends in historical price data.

You can choose to be either of 4 types of traders:

  • Swing Trader: Swing traders aim to capture shorter-term price movements within a trend. They look for points at which a currency pair might change direction. As a swing trader, you will mostly be using the patterns and structure on the higher time-frame like Daily-Weekly timeframes.
  • Scalper: Scalpers make very short-term trades, sometimes holding positions for just seconds or minutes. They aim to profit from small price fluctuations. 5 mins-3 mins-1 mins or even the secs time-frames. Scalpers are “in and out” types of traders.
  • Intra-Day Trader: Day traders open and close positions within the same trading day, avoiding the risks associated with overnight exposure. Day Traders focus more on taking advantage of the move that is happening right now using 1hour-30mins -15mins time-frames.
  • Position Trader: This type of trader has a longer-term view than the swing trader. They focus more on macroeconomics which is understanding the depth of fundamental analysis. They stay in trades for longer periods of time and have a larger capital to withstand all the short-term fluctuations in the markets.

Pitfalls to Avoid in Forex Trading

  • Overtrading: Overtrading happens when traders decide to open numerous positions, often due to emotions or the urge to recoup losses quickly. Such a practice can result in Increased transaction costs and greater exposure to risks.
  • Lack of Risk Management: Failing to implement proper risk management techniques, such as setting stop-loss orders, can result in significant losses. It’s crucial to protect your capital.
  • Emotional Trading: Emotional reactions, such as fear and greed, can cloud judgment and lead to impulsive decisions. Trading should be based on a well-thought-out plan, not emotions.
  • Ignoring Stop-Loss Orders: Traders sometimes hesitate to trigger stop-loss orders, hoping that the market will reverse in their favor. This can lead to larger losses than initially intended.
  • Overleveraging: Using excessive leverage can amplify gains, but it also magnifies losses. Trading with too much leverage can wipe out a trading account quickly. Using a lot size too big for your account exposes your trading account even when the market is fluctuating, before moving in the direction you entered for. You want to give your trades room to play out.

How to Choose A Forex Trading Strategy

Here are some common tips that traders often find helpful:

  • Continuous Learning: The forex market is constantly evolving and money is always in transactions daily. Traders need to stay informed about market news, economic events, and global trends. As well as following up closely with the pairs and assets they are trading.
  • Backtesting: Before implementing a strategy, it’s essential to test it on historical data to assess the viability of that strategy and get very familiar with how you would use it in every day trading. Precisely outline the parameters of your trading strategy, encompassing entry and exit conditions, position sizing, stop-loss thresholds, and take-profit objectives. This involves replicating how you would have traded in accordance with your strategy within the designated time frame.
  • Forward Testing: Implement your strategy in a paper or demo trading account to observe its performance in real-time conditions with live market data.
  • Diversification: Spreading risk across multiple currency pairs can help mitigate losses. It can be helpful to master only a few pairs to be well acquainted with their flow, and also make sure the risk is spread.

How much profit is 50 pips? ›

In the image below, a pip is the fourth decimal. Pips are one of the ways by which traders calculate how much profit they made or lost on a trade. For example, if you enter a long position on GBP/USD at 1.6550 and it moves to 1.6600 by the time you close your position you have made a 50 pip profit.

How much is 50 pips equal to? ›

How much is 50 pips or 100 pips? A pip usually equals 0.0001 of a Forex pair, so 50 pips equals 0.005, 100 pips—0.01. If one pip is worth $5, 50 pips are worth $250, 100 pips—$500.
